Ria Mae's 2011 Concert History

Ria Mae is a Juno nominated Canadian singer-songwriter; she is from Halifax, Nova Scotia. She was voted Best New Artist 2010 in Halifax weekly The Coast. Her first EP, Between The Bad, was recorded at Spaces Between Studios and produced by Mae and Don McKay. She has shared the stage with performers such as Classified, Coleman Hell, Amelia Curran, The Cliks, and Hidden Cameras. Her song "Clothes Off" has reached Platinum certification in Canada.
